Choosing the Right Advertising Platforms
Selecting the appropriate advertising platform is crucial for nonprofits aiming to maximize their digital marketing efforts. Nonprofits should consider platforms that align with their mission and target audience. Popular platforms such as Google Ads and Facebook offer advanced targeting options that allow organizations to reach specific demographics and interests, making it easier to connect with potential supporters. Evaluating the features and audience of each platform can help nonprofits choose the best fit for their advertising campaigns.
Nonprofits should also seek advertising partners that offer favorable remuneration structures. Some platforms operate on a pay-per-click model, where organizations only pay when a user interacts with their ad. Others may offer flat-rate pricing or performance-based compensation, which can be essential for organizations working with limited budgets. Understanding these financial implications can enable nonprofits to optimize their online monetization strategies and make every dollar count.

Measuring Advertising Success and Revenue
To ensure that digital advertising efforts are effective, nonprofits must establish clear metrics for success. Key performance indicators, or KPIs, can include the click-through rate, conversion rate, and overall engagement with advertising campaigns. By analyzing these metrics, organizations can determine which advertising platforms and strategies yield the highest return on investment. Continuous monitoring allows for adjustments in real-time to optimize performance and maximize advertising revenue.
Understanding the financial impact of advertising is equally crucial. Nonprofits should track the revenue generated from online promotion, including any income derived from partnerships with advertising networks. This includes assessing the effectiveness of various advertising partners and the remuneration received from each channel. By analyzing the correlation between advertising spend and revenue generated, organizations can identify profitable avenues for future investment.
